The 50-kg block is hoisted up the incline using the cable and motor arrangement shown. The coefficient of kinetic friction between the   block   and   the   surface is m= 0.4. If the block is initially moving up the plane at v0 = 2  m>s, and at this instant (t  = 0) the motor  develops a tension in the cord of = (300 + 120 1t) N, where is in seconds, determine the velocity of the block when t  =  2 s.
